Output e23fee8b391a2124d3ca5d2ecab743437e614a1e7fb7c60637afe4cd3b7de4fe:0

value
132256074
script pubkey
OP_0 OP_PUSHBYTES_20 66691bfa5ce99b983369f2c8c8101574a0a2b403
address
ltc1qve53h7juaxdesvmf7tyvsyq4wjs29dqr5a43kp
transaction
e23fee8b391a2124d3ca5d2ecab743437e614a1e7fb7c60637afe4cd3b7de4fe
spent
true